Apr 10:40 lisp/loaddefs.el Since 5425793530331136 == 1263291 << 32, this suggests that there's a mismatch between the ABI that Emacs is assuming and the ABI that the 'stat' system call is actually using. Perhaps it's a bug in the way largefile mode is being set up (see Autoconf's AC_SYS_LARGFILE, which Emacs uses). Perhaps some code is compiled in largefile mode, and other code is not -- that's a no-no. Or, as Andreas Schwab suggests, if you're mixing code that's compiled by incompatible compilers, that would cause these symptoms. One other thought: is Emacs invoking 'stat' directly, or indirectly via the 'stat' defined in lib/stat.c? If the latter, perhaps there's something messed up with the indirection.
